That site doesn't show anything for me. There is a box on the electoral register you can check so you don't appear on the edited register. In theory these type of places should only be able to get the edited register. Judging by the results of my search the theory held up.

And on the topic of security........I'd say an immobiliser would do it. An alarm will make lots of noise and be ignored! A decent immobiliser will Isolate at least to or more circuits making it hard for some one to start your car. But with any kind of time if they want it they'll have it, after all how many times has anyone questioned you for fiddling under the bonnet in a car park? :( :blink: :(

on the topic of security i think it would be worth someone making a gear lock for 7 type cars. on the quantum i had the gear lock was fitted as a factory option by quantum. all you could see on the car was a little barrel that stuck out 2 inches from the tunnel. stick it in gear, turn the lock and it stays only in that gear. so no fast get away if parked in the open, and if you parked it facing a wall, and put it in a forward gear it wont go anywhere. cant understand why these havent appeared for sevens, unless theres a technical reason.

 

as for the B4u website i agree with mitch (on the new thread) if it bothers you, suggest that there is a legal reason why they should remove you. One of the provisions of the Data Protection Act is that information kept about you is relvant and up to date. therefore if you found information that was out of date, as several have, you could threaten them with the law for failing to abide by this section of the act.
